Saltora Population - Paschim Medinipur, West Bengal

Saltora is a small village located in Binpur - II Block of Paschim Medinipur district, West Bengal with total 39 families residing. The Saltora village has population of 173 of which 87 are males while 86 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Saltora village population of children with age 0-6 is 30 which makes up 17.34 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Saltora village is 989 which is higher than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Saltora as per census is 765,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Saltora village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Saltora village was 88.11 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Saltora Male literacy stands at 92.86 % while female literacy rate was 83.56 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 24.28 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 10.98 % of total population in Saltora village.

Work Profile

In Saltora village out of total population, 75 were engaged in work activities. 66.67 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 33.33 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 75 workers engaged in Main Work, 16 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 33 were Agricultural labourer.
